Biology     Glossary (e.g. epibenthic)

It has lengths of 30 cm, total body length; 6 and 12 cm, carapace length. Occurs at a depth range from 5 and 112 m (Ref. 4). It has been observed to open live Tridacna sp. shells and it feeds on mollusks and dead fish (Ref. 4).
